Why did we make the decision? Because of a steadily declining market for pen-based PDAs and noted over the past several quarters by analyst firms like IDC and Gartner.So true that it borders on patently obvious. But I think Dell had other reasons for discontinuing the Axim. With all the troubles
the company is suffering from lately, such as conceding first place to HP, it has to concentrate on its core business--computers--to recover. In short, it was a matter of survival.Interestingly, while the Windows Mobile Powered PDAs are no longer available from Dell's main online store, Dell UK still carries them. So if you really wanted to own an Axim here's your last call. Personally I've never been able to use one but I always hear that the Axim's low price meant it was a low-cost entry into the PDA world.
The good news for Axim users out there is that Direct 2 Dell promises continued support. And the availability of peripherals while supplies last.
